1973: A gentle breeze blows over a field of tall, green grass in Scapegoat Wilderness, Montana. A blonde woman in a light-colored shirt and pants bends over, holding a fishing rod with a bow, as she catches a fish near overgrown weeds. The scene captures a quiet moment in nature, with the woman smiling as she reels in her catch.
